Yes, you are in danger.

First, you are in legal danger. If law enforcement catches you, you could be facing criminal charges for drug possession.

From smoking pot, you are in danger of developing smoking related diseases like lung cancer, emphysema, and throat cancer.

From cocaine, you are in danger of causing damage to your nose and sinuses, and you could be causing damage to your heart and cardiovascular system.

Both pot and cocaine can worsen depression, in different ways, and also taking those street drugs could interfere with Zoloft.

Does you pdoc know that you are using pot and cocaine? Maybe if you talk about why it is difficult for you to quit, he can add other meds to take care of those symptoms in a medically safe, legal way.
